What is the gravitational constant g?

Physics
1 answer:
3241004551 [841]3 years ago
3 0

Answer: In SI units, G has the value 6.67 × 10-11 Newtons kg-2 m2. The direction of the force is in a straight line between the two bodies and is attractive. Thus, an apple falls from a tree because it feels the gravitational force of the Earth and is therefore subject to “gravity”.

An ice skater starts with a velocity of 2.25 m/s in a 50.0 direction. after 8.33 m/s in a 120 direction. what is the y-component
Bond [772]

The y-component of the acceleration is 0.33 m/s^2

Explanation:

The y-component of the acceleration is given by:

a_y = \frac{v_y-u_y}{t}

where

v_y is the y-component of the  final velocity

u_y is the y-component of the initial velocity

t is the time elapsed

For the ice skater in this problem, we have:

u_y = u sin \theta_1 = (2.25 m/s)(sin 50.0^{\circ})=1.72 m/s

where

u = 2.25 m/s is the initial velocity

\theta_1 = 50.0^{\circ} is the initial  direction

v_y = v sin \theta_2 = (4.65)(sin 120^{\circ})=4.03 m/s, where

v = 4.65 m/s is the final velocity

\theta_2 = 120.0^{\circ} is the final direction

The time elapsed is

t = 8.33 s

Therefore, we can find the y-component of the acceleration:

a_y=\frac{4.03-1.72}{8.33}=0.33 m/s^2
